<br />5. OWNERSHIP OF MATERIALS
<br />This Agreement creates a non-exclusive and perpetual license for City to copy, use,
<br />modify, reuse, or sublicense any and all copyrights, designs, and other intellectual property
<br />embodied in plans, specifications, studies, drawings, estimates, and other documents or works of
<br />authorship fixed in any tangible medium of expression, including but not limited to, physical
<br />drawings or data magnetically or otherwise recorded on computer diskettes, which are prepared or
<br />caused to be prepared by Consultant under this Agreement ("Documents & Data"). Consultant
<br />shall require all subcontractors to agree in writing that City is granted a non-exclusive and
<br />perpetual license for any Documents & Data the subcontractor prepares under this Agreement.
<br />Consultant represents and warrants that Consultant has the legal right to license any and all
<br />Documents & Data. Consultant makes no such representation and warranty in regard to
<br />Documents & Data which were provided to Consultant by the City. City shall not be limited in
<br />any way in its use of the Documents and Data at any time, provided that any such use not within
<br />the purposes intended by this Agreement shall be at City's sole risk.
